Obverse description Crowned bust of the king to the right, in armor with a high shoulder pad.
Obverse script Latin
Obverse lettering SIGIS I REX POLO DO TO PRVSS 1535
(Translation: Sigismund I King of Poland, Lord of the Prussian Land)
Reverse description The crest shield with a small Austrian shield in the middle . On the sides of the shield are the letters CS: Cracovia - Spitikus (Spytek Tarnowski, Grand Treasurer of the Crown).
Reverse script Latin
Reverse lettering IVSTVS VT PALMA FLOREBIT
(Translation: Just as the palm will flourish)
